administrator@mydr4000 > system --setname --name swsys-60 Successfully updated hostname. If no options are specified, the following prompts are shown: administrator@mydr4000 > system --setname --name missing: Name for the machine. --setcompression [--fast, --best] To set the compression type to use on the data stored by a DR4000 system, enter the example command string at the system prompt (--fast is the default setting): administrator@mydr4000 > system --setcompression --fast Successfully updated compression level. If no options are specified, the following prompts are shown: administrator@mydr4000 > system --setcompression Must have either fast or best. --setcompression - Sets the compression type to use on the stored data. Usage: System --setcompression [--fast] [--best] --fast Uses the fastest compression algorithm. --best Compresses to get the most space savings. --setdate [--date , --timezone ] To set the date and time zone on a DR4000 system, enter the example command string at the system prompt: NOTE: To set a date (month/day/hour/minute) for the DR4000 system, enter values using the following format where specifying the four-digit year [[CC]YY] and seconds [.ss] are optional: MMDDhhmm [[CC]YY][.ss]]. 54 Managing the DR4000 System
